The Resident Services Administrator reports to the Community Manager. The Resident Services Administrator is responsible for the clerical administration for the Community Association. Position is tasked with managing the front desk and seeing to the needs of all visitors and callers.

The Resident Services Administrator will:

  • answer incoming calls and greet all persons arriving at the office
  • provide relevant information and direct requests or deliver accurate message appropriately
  • accept Association payments, process checks for immediate posting and assist membership with payment options/methods
  • operate and maintain office equipment to include printers, fax, copier, scanner, telephone and online services
  • prepare all outgoing mail or packages & use scales/ postage meters to affix postage, maintain sufficient postage
  • open, date stamp, log in, and appropriately disseminate all incoming mail and deliveries
  • update and maintain electronic lot files and other community documents
  • update community resident email address list and add to Constant Contact on a monthly basis
  • maintain a variety of association forms including welcome information
  • track inventory, maintain and order office supplies
  • ensure appropriate Homeowner Files, Documents and Accounting files are processed and stored for proper retention online or hard copy, as appropriate
  • participate in community events and meetings as needed
  • prepare and distribute periodic reports as assigned
  • track expenses, organize and process receipts for financial statement accruals
  • perform community lot audit

The ideal candidate will:

  • have the ability to communicate effectively both orally and in writing
  • have excellent telephone manner, with a commitment to the highest customer service possible
  • have excellent organizational skills and be efficient in work ethic
  • be a multi-tasker and self-starter
  • be computer literate with knowledge of Microsoft programs, and other PC-based software
  • exercise independent judgment in carrying out instructions
  • have experience in homeowner association operations

Candidates must:

  • attend meetings and community events, which may take place outside of normal business hours
  • be flexible and have a stable means of transportation

If driving is, or becomes, a requirement of the role, it is required, at all times, that you hold a valid state driver’s license for the class of vehicle you are driving, maintain a clean motor vehicle report, and hold current automobile insurance at statutory limits. You must notify Human Resources immediately regarding any change to your motor vehicle standing. CCMC may periodically review motor vehicle reports to ensure compliance with these requirements.

The physical requirements can vary, but generally, they may include:

  • Mobility: Ability to walk the grounds long distances in various weather conditions.
  • Lifting and Carrying: Occasionally lifting and carrying supplies or equipment up to 25 pounds.
  • Extended Sitting or Standing: Capability to sit or stand for extended periods during meetings or events.
  • Manual Dexterity: Skills in using technology, including computers and mobile devices.
